What I have changed! (COVID19)
STEP BY STEP WHAT TO EXPECT:

Arriving at the Treatment Room - I'll ask that you arrive ON TIME for the appointment and not early, and were possible to wait in your car. Our waiting room will still be of use and will have socially distanced easily cleanable seating available. I also ask that you ARRIVE ALONE were possible and to leave belonging in your car/at home. I have HAND SANITIZING STATIONS available in the treatment room, I'll ask that you use them before and after you appointment.
The Treatment- Treatments will remain very much the same, however of course implementing new strategies to maintain pristine hygiene in the treatment room.:

The treatment beds will be cleaned using the appropriate sanitizing agents following each client, with a huge focus of course on the face holes. The same will be done for all high contact surfaces in the room.
Disposable Face cradle covers-medical-grade will be used.
Hygiene Roll to be used on treatment beds.
I have changed to hygiene wipe & clean pillow, these can be sanitized between clients.
I have contactless payments available, however cash/card/bacs etc. is still welcome.
Cleaning- I have implemented 15 MINUTE CLEANING PERIODS between clients, this will have a focus on high contact areas such as door handles, seats, treatment beds etc., so you can rest assured the cleanliness of the treatment room will be perfect. At the beginning and end of each day, the treatment room will have a full DEEP CLEAN, by using the appropriate sanitizing agents and avoid cross contamination.
Your Therapist- You can rest assured I will be maintaining the highest

standards in regards to self hygiene. I will be frequently washing my hands, particularly between clients and will also be wearing the appropriate PPE. Government guidelines currently suggest for close contact surfaces that they wear a shield visor when with clients, these will be compulsory.
Following Your Treatment- After your treatment ends, You will be encouraged to wash your hands or use the hand sanitisers and try to avoid waiting in the welcome room were possible.
COVID Symptoms?
If you have symptoms of COVID-19, you must not attend.
The list of main symptoms are :

◌ High temperature
◌ New, continuous cough
◌ Loss or change to your sense of smell or taste
** Please Note: If you have been outside the UK last 14 days, and have symptoms of Covid19, please do not attend for any treatment.
